Output edf2866940e55c9f0fc353684d99e2ea1e04637759dc9586ea45e42a0910401a:1

value
48118
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58aa3391f8c8ad3cd1deb47684b0ec8e5d2bde1c543d23e2a1148b4f2c45e588
address
tb1ptz4r8y0cezkne5w7k3mgfv8v3ewjhhsu2s7j8c4pzj957tz9ukyqndg8tq
transaction
edf2866940e55c9f0fc353684d99e2ea1e04637759dc9586ea45e42a0910401a
confirmations
33409
spent
true